About Our Top Soil

Our top soil is sourced from old farm lands. As these new developments are going in, the builder will move all the topsoil into a pile to build on the bed rock. That pile is then screened like the photo above. Our soil is screened down to 3/8ths inch (the smallest grade for topsoil) and shipped out in dump trucks. At 3/8ths, there is still room for little tiny rocks and occasionally a very small twig. This stuff is all great to put under your sod, you just don’t want anything bulky that will make your lawn bumpy.

Can You Dump Over A Fence?

The short answer is yes, but in most cases it is not ideal. We have what are called slinger trucks. These have a conveyor belt that can shoot material over fences. This includes top soil, fill dirt, sand and more. Everything except sod. While this is great, prices generally double due to the truck and man power being much higher. In most cases, it is most cost-effective to get a normal dump truck and use a skid steer (aka a bobcat) to bring the material to where you need it.

For regular dump trucks, the clearance when dumping is very low and there is no way to dump over a fence.
